[PATCH] iommu/virtio: Build virtio-iommu as module
From: Jean-Philippe Brucker Now that the infrastructure changes are in place, enable virtio-iommu to be built as a module. Remove the redundant pci_request_acs() call, since it's not exported but is already invoked during DMA setup. Signed-off-by: Jean-Philippe Brucker --- This conflicts with the multiplatform work [1] since they both change Kconfig. Locally I have this patch applied on top of that series but there is no functional dependency between the two.
